Sunday, February 13, 2011

A Mother Speaks

Eloquent words from a friend in this club that none of us ever wished to join.

Thank you Ceil, for sharing this so poignantly.

Ceil, Word Off 2011 Starlight Theatre, Terlingua, TX from sally martin on Vimeo.


